Educational Cost Constraints in Kansas

Kansas is recognized for its significant historical contributions to education, yet the state still grapples with cost constraints that inhibit equitable access to quality education for minority students. According to the Kansas Department of Education, funding disparities across school districts disproportionately affect schools with higher minority populations, leading to gaps in resources and educational opportunities. In the 2021-2022 school year, funding per pupil in Kansas averaged $13,200, but districts in minority communities have often received less, impacting their ability to offer advanced educational tools and programs.

These cost constraints primarily affect minority students in both urban and rural Kansas. Urban areas, such as Kansas City and Wichita, face concentrations of low-income families who struggle to provide necessary school supplies, while rural districts lack the financial resources to adopt modern educational technologies. Consequently, teachers in these areas often report feeling underprepared to meet the diverse needs of their students, resulting in disparities in academic performance that can affect students' long-term educational outcomes.
